A leading healthcare technology firm in the United Kingdom seeks an experienced product leader to drive product strategy and execution. The ideal candidate will have over 15 years of experience in product management, particularly within healthcare technology, and will lead a high-performing, remote team.
Responsibilities include:
- Defining the product vision
- Engaging with stakeholders
- Ensuring products meet market needs
This role offers competitive compensation and the opportunity to influence healthcare outcomes.
